Description
American Traveler is seeking an experienced RN for a Stepdown Intermediate Care (PCU/Telemetry) position requiring BLS and ACLS certifications and a minimum of 2 years of experience.
Details
- 13-week contract with night shift hours (7:00 PM – 7:30 AM)
- 15-bed Stepdown Intermediate Care unit with all patients on continuous telemetry monitoring
- Patient population includes cardiac, stroke, and progressive care patients
- Unit is staffed with RNs and PCTs
- Hospital provides 24/7 hospitalist coverage along with ER and respiratory therapy support
Requirements
- Active RN license in Indiana or a Compact state
- Current AHA BLS and AHA ACLS certifications required
- NIH Stroke Scale (NIHSS) certification required
- Minimum of 2 years of RN experience required
- Proficiency in cardiac rhythm interpretation and management of cardiac drips
- Must possess a valid US Social Security Number and maintain a US home address
- Two professional references required for consideration
- Copy of Driver's License required for consideration
- Skills checklist required for consideration
Additional Information
- Responsible for coordinating and delivering care to assigned PCU/stepdown patients
- Local candidates are welcome to apply, though a radius rule applies that may affect the travel pay rate — the applicable radius varies by state
- COVID vaccination is not required for this position
